What did I do today with my NSX?

I installed the new battery with reversed polarity. :frown: That's what I did. Sparks flying everywhere and the horn went crazy. Just touched the connections for less than a second. Everything was dead after that, excpet the alarm system. Fried the main 120A fuse, which explains that. Bypassed it temporarily to see if everything worked. Electricity was back, but the car didn't crank. Bypassed the starter cut relay as per the book, and it fired right up. So either the starter relay is gone or something that should provide ground to the relay is fried. I'll start with a new starter cut relay. Tomorrow.

More like the last 5 days, pre Spring/track prep:

Replaced Fuel Filter
Removed battery- cleaned tray and battery, checked levels.
Brushed down and cleaned battery terminals
Checked torque on rear top hats
Checked Rotors and pad life
Applied Shin-etsu* silicone to all seals [trunk/targa/hood/doors]
Lubed window rails
Checked all Suspension bolts [ a few more to check, like pivot control and end links]
Checked 'travel' of suspension on all 4 corners
Applied new coats of plasti-dip to nose
Applied new coats of 3m defender to front quarter panels
Washed rims and applied 2 coats Klass sealant

Still left to do, change clutch fluid [maybe this weekend] - done

* Also known as "Larry's Lube" in the Tri-State, NY,NY,PA area
